Trip Details and Itinerary
Now that you have secured your spot and payment is taken care of, let’s dive into the exciting trip details and itinerary for your trekking experience in Sapa. Get ready to explore the stunning Sapa trekking routes and learn about local cultural experiences.
The duration of the trip is approximately one day, starting with a convenient pickup from your Sapa hotel. The trip is conducted in English, ensuring clear communication between you and your expert local guide.
During the trek, you’ll have the opportunity to explore the breathtaking Muong Hoa Valley, visit the charming Ta Van village, and discover the traditional Cat Cat village. Along the way, you’ll be treated to magnificent views of Mount Fansipan, the highest peak in Indochina.
To refuel and recharge, a delicious local lunch is included in the itinerary. At the end of the activity, you’ll be safely returned to the meeting point.

Highlights and Sightseeing

After a convenient pickup from their hotel, travelers can look forward to seeing the captivating highlights and breathtaking sightseeing opportunities that await them in Sapa. Sapa is renowned for its rich local culture and stunning scenic landscapes, making it a paradise for nature lovers and culture enthusiasts alike.
Here are some of the top highlights and sightseeing options in Sapa:
- Explore the picturesque Muong Hoa Valley, with its terraced rice fields and charming ethnic minority villages.
- Visit Ta Van village, where you can interact with the friendly locals and learn about their traditional way of life.
- Discover Cat Cat village, home to the Black Hmong people, and admire the traditional handicrafts and unique architecture.
